I'd say fit it yourself ,Theres loads if info and tips on here and as your fitting it You'll know how it goes together if anything breaks .It's only a 1 day job and not too hard at all ;)
Over the last 5 years I've owned the Disco I've done loads of little jobs and a couple of big ones (head gasket, Timing belt etc) and every time you do a job your knowledge and skills will improve to the point where things become less and less intimidating and if you break down you'll have a better chance of getting going again without help :D Comming from a life that revolved around motorcycles I knew nothing about Landrovers when I bought it but buy a manual and you will learn quick and save loads of dosh to spend on more goodies :D
